Yemeni Forces Mount Missile Attacks against Saudi Forces in Najran

TEHRAN (Tasnim) – The Yemeni army announced that it has launched missile attacks on the positions of Saudi forces coalition in the kingdom’s southwestern province of Najran and inflicted heavy casualties on them.

The missile command of the Yemeni army said the Arabian Peninsula country’s forces pounded several bases of the Saudi military in Najran, the Arabic-language Al Mayadeen reported on Wednesday.

In another operation, four mercenaries of the Saudi regime were killed following the explosion of a bomb planted by the Yemeni army and Popular Committees also in Najran province.

According to the report, a military source said dozens of the mercenaries of the fugitive former President Abd Rabbuh Mansour Hadi, a close ally of Riyadh, were also killed in Yemen’s southwestern province of Taiz.

The attacks by the Yemeni forces were carried out in retaliation for the continued massacre of civilians by a Saudi-led coalition in Yemen.

Since March 25, 2015, Saudi Arabia and some of its Arab allies have been carrying out airstrikes against the Houthi Ansarullah movement in an attempt to restore power to Hadi.

According to Yemen’s Legal Center of Rights and Development, the Saudi campaign has claimed the lives of over 12,000 Yemenis and left more than 20,000 others wounded.
